While many dietary guidelines recommend around 2-4 servings of fruit daily, one systematic review of 95 scientific studies suggested that a daily intake of 10 servings of fruits and vegetables combined was associated with the lowest disease risk. This raises a key question for many health-conscious individuals: is 7 servings of fruit a day too much for optimal health?
